Output 3fe7a08808773c753e1a6031a9bf2ffb1dc43bbdc2db74e1203a26e3b074227e:0

value
3679484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e37d36491bf42575ac9d99fbc88d002e067cee OP_EQUAL
address
33QtcDYhenCw5TGnroAvf92EH4J4SSdeY6
transaction
3fe7a08808773c753e1a6031a9bf2ffb1dc43bbdc2db74e1203a26e3b074227e
confirmations
157602
spent
false